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is required for accessing funds over $150,000. This can be done by taking a charge on assets, and may include registration on the PPSR or making as a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a guarantee to repay credit that is generally in nature rather than stipulating the security for a particular as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ally liable in the event that the company lender is not able to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been granted to individuals who own personal property (including goods or assets). The PPSR allows priority over personal property to be assigned according to the date the registration of a security interest.
A caveat is a legal document that is filed to offer the public notice of a legal claim on a property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ner uses assets they own to secure the loan. The asset can be either an individual property, such as the family home, or a business property like a truck or piece or equipment.
The majority of lenders, including the largest banks, are inclined to guarantee loans against assets.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, then the asset could be sold by the lender. In essence, it is an opportunity to secure new financing by ta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
